December 07, 2021, 08:09:08 pm

STM32F103RCT6 Using Problem

Started by Masonhuang, August 27, 2021, 01:00:04 pm

Hi, all
Several days ago, I bought a devboard with a STM32F103RCT6 chip on it. According to the datasheets, that chip has 48 KB of RAM and 256 KB of flashrom.
However, when using the linux arm-gdb and the st-util and st-info, they say that the chip actually has 64 KB of RAM (so more then exptected).
(STM32F103RCT6 datasource: stm32f103rct6 chip datasheet
Using gdb (writing to memory and reading back from it), it does look at there is indeed 64 KB of RAM in the chip, ... but I do not find any reference to that chip with 64 KB of RAM.

Is there anyone has any idea what is going on here?


Which board exactly did you purchase? What is the hardware revision? The name and the hardware revision are printed on the board itself.
We usually use STM32F103RBT6 in our designs.
